Fannie Mae Predicts 'Modest Recession' in 2023

Fannie Mae has downgraded its economic forecasts for the rest of 2022 and 2023 and now projects a “modest recession” next year.

Fannie Mae2 e1615570153127 280x280Economists for the federally backed housing finance giant cited the Federal Reserve’s plans for aggressive monetary tightening along with decades-high inflation and fallout from Russia’s war in Ukraine.

“Consequently, we expect home sales, house prices, and mortgage volumes to cool over the next two years,” Fannie Mae chief economist Doug Duncan said in a press release.
